Output 680886a60f1254dd21657779d7ffdd32e526f8dac1f8e7885a831537586e57ee:1

value
223880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 870b1636ab16f0f9211fb49a5ba794d8a2d74194 OP_EQUALVERIFY OP_CHECKSIG
address
1DK3WDjRUGTvESyxHUprDFhRWWec9Jp1VX
transaction
680886a60f1254dd21657779d7ffdd32e526f8dac1f8e7885a831537586e57ee
confirmations
255590
spent
true